Sir Richard Branson and Olympic sailor Ben Ainslie set sail on transatlantic challenge

Oct. 22, 2008
Sir Richard Branson has set off on his transatlantic record bid from New York with Olympic sailing champion Ben Ainslie after dedicating the expedition to his late friend and fellow adventurer Steve Fossett.
